Course Overview

In an increasingly competitive and compliance-driven global economy, organizations must ensure that their tendering and contract management practices are robust, efficient, and aligned with strategic goals. The Tender Evaluation and Contract Management Program by Pideya Learning Academy is thoughtfully designed to address this imperative by equipping procurement, contracting, and supply chain professionals with deep insights into the entire pre-award process. From designing clear scopes of work to executing detailed bid evaluations, the course provides a structured framework for achieving excellence in vendor selection and contract planning.
According to the World Commerce & Contracting Association, poor contract management leads to an average value leakage of nearly 9% of annual revenue, a staggering figure that directly affects profitability and operational continuity. Moreover, a recent Deloitte Global CPO Survey revealed that 79% of procurement leaders are focused on cost reduction, but only a fraction have optimized their sourcing and contract evaluation systems. These statistics underscore the growing demand for professionals who can lead transparent, strategic, and well-governed procurement initiatives.

Course Outline

Module 1: Fundamentals of Contracting Principles
Key components of a legally binding agreement Essential terminology in contract administration Common pitfalls in drafting contract documents Lifecycle of a typical contractual engagement Strategic intent behind procurement contracts Overview of tendering objectives and procurement alignment Comparative study: Single-stage vs. dual-stage bidding mechanisms Tendering lifecycle and procedural flow
Module 2: Strategic Contract Design and Scope Development
Building a contract strategy framework Evaluation of procurement methodologies (open, selective, negotiated) Structuring an effective scope of services Application of decision matrices in contract planning Key drafting guidelines for scope and deliverables Legal and operational impact of vague contract descriptions Essential clauses and governing provisions Designing sourcing and supplier selection strategies
Module 3: Contract Models and Pricing Mechanisms
Overview of fixed-price contract types Firm-fixed and lump-sum models Contracts with economic price adjustments Performance-based incentive contract frameworks Comparative overview of contract risk allocation models
Module 4: Flexible and Reimbursable Contract Frameworks
Cost-plus percentage and fixed-fee models Award fee and performance-linked fee structures Structuring incentive-based reimbursable contracts Time & material (T&M) agreements Contractual considerations for intellectual property ownership Non-traditional contracting forms (e.g., public-private partnerships) Principles of international contracting practices Process for contract modifications and change orders
Module 5: Bid Management and Communication Protocols
Identifying and inviting qualified bidders Organizing bidder conferences and pre-bid meetings Protocols for receiving, securing, and timestamping submissions Legal compliance in opening bids Internal communication and stakeholder coordination
Module 6: Bid Evaluation and Award Strategy
Framework for bid evaluation procedures Initial screening and eligibility verification Technical responsiveness and specification matching Financial bid analysis and commercial benchmarking Total cost of ownership and value-for-money assessment Evaluation using Most Economically Advantageous Tender (MEAT) Structured scoring and weighting techniques Contract award and post-award notification process
Module 7: Risk and Compliance Management in Contracting
Identification and classification of contractual risks Legal and regulatory compliance in procurement Ethical considerations and anti-bribery clauses Dispute resolution mechanisms and arbitration clauses Force majeure and termination provisions Performance guarantees and bonding requirements
Module 8: Vendor Governance and Post-Award Contract Management
Onboarding and performance monitoring of suppliers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) in contract monitoring Managing change requests and scope creep Payment schedules and milestone tracking Contract renewal, closure, and performance audits
Module 9: Contract Drafting Tools and Automation Techniques
Templates and standard contracting toolkits Digital contract lifecycle management (CLM) solutions Workflow automation and e-signature integration Record-keeping and version control best practices
Module 10: Global Trends and Innovations in Procurement Contracts
E-tendering and digital procurement platforms Use of AI and data analytics in contract analysis Green procurement and sustainability clauses Cross-border contracting: legal implications and trade agreements Framework agreements and strategic sourcing alliances
